It has been a remarkable run for Tiger Stadium voices and continuity. I posted this a while back but am too lazy to go find the post, but over the last 55 years or so, we have had only 3 radio voices, 2 PA voices, and 2 band announcers.

So whether any of these people are great, awful, or in between in your opinion, 3 generations of LSU football fans have some combination of these voices ingrained in a LOT of their LSU experience.

I am a little too young to remember Sid Crocker and John Ferguson, so my Tiger Stadium experience for a long time was Borne' on the PA, Jim Mackey bringing the band on the field pregame and halftime, and Hawthorne in my earphones during the game. It was a top-notch experience that I appreciate more now than I did at the time.
